What Triggered the Gold and Silver Market Crash

The market reaction followed an announcement related to future economic and monetary leadership in the United States. Investors quickly reassessed expectations around interest rates, inflation control, and the strength of the U.S. dollar.

As confidence grew that tighter monetary policy could be introduced, demand for gold and silver weakened sharply. Since precious metals do not offer interest returns, higher rate expectations often reduce their appeal among institutional and retail investors.

Why Gold and Silver Reacted So Sharply

Gold and silver prices are highly sensitive to political signals and monetary policy expectations. The announcement signaled a potential shift toward stricter financial control, which typically strengthens the U.S. dollar.

A stronger dollar makes precious metals more expensive for global buyers, reducing demand. At the same time, investors often move capital away from metals toward interest-bearing assets when rate hikes appear more likely.

What Happens Next for Gold and Silver Prices

Market analysts believe gold and silver could remain volatile in the near term as investors digest political developments and upcoming economic data. Some expect further downside pressure if expectations of tighter policy strengthen.

However, others argue that any signs of renewed inflation or geopolitical tension could quickly restore demand for precious metals, leading to a rebound in prices.
